Key Features

  • 12-Point Internal Geometry: Double-hex design provides six points of contact per side, minimizing rounding and cam-out on both six-point and twelve-point fasteners
  • 3/8-Inch Drive: Industry-standard drive size compatible with universal ratchets, torque wrenches, and pneumatic impact tools
  • Short Profile: Reduced overall length (28–30mm depending on size) enables access in confined spaces without sacrificing strength
  • Satin Chrome Finish: Durable, corrosion-resistant steel coating suitable for wet and high-use environments
  • Knurled Grip Band: Center knurling improves hand grip and prevents slipping during manual operation
  • Chamfered Mouth: Slightly beveled entry point reduces fastener misalignment and speeds up engagement
  • Precision Machining: Tight tolerances ensure reliable fit with 3/8-inch drive tools and fasteners

Technical Specifications

Size (mm) SKU D1 (mm) D2 (mm) T (mm) L (mm)
8 523208 11.8 17.0 8 28
9 523209 13.2 17.0 8 28
10 523210 14.5 17.0 8 28
11 523211 15.7 17.0 8 28
12 523212 17.0 16.0 8 28
13 523213 18.0 16.5 8 28
14 523214 19.6 17.0 12 28
15 523215 20.9 18.0 12 28
16 523216 22.0 19.0 12 28
17 523217 23.4 20.0 12 30
18 523218 24.6 21.0 12 30
19 523219 26.0 23.0 14 30
20 523220 27.1 24.0 14 30
21 523221 28.0 25.0 14 30
22 523222 29.6 26.0 14 30
23 523223 31.6 27.0 14 30
24 523224 32.0 28.0 16 30

Nomenclature:

  • D1: Socket hex width (across flats)
  • D2: Socket outer diameter (at widest point)
  • T: Drive end thickness
  • L: Overall length
